Zita Lefaive Obituary
We are saddened to announce the passing of our Dear Mother, Zita Lefaive, on Saturday, September 3, 2022, peacefully, with her family by her side. She is survived by her loving husband of 71 years, Bernard Lefaive.
She will be dearly missed by her children, Don (Theresa), Anne (Ron), Richard (Joanne), Paul (Janet), Denis, and David (Sharon). Predeceased by daughter, Lucille (Donn). Zita was a proud Grandmother to Jessica, Krista, Scott, Angie, Greg, Amanda, Erin, Ryan, Jason, Nicole, Eric, and Crystal. Loving Great Grandmother to 18. Dearly missed by many Nieces, Nephews, and Great Friends.
Dear daughter of Herb and Eliza Lalonde. Dear sister of Alcime (Lorette), Albert (Irene), Ralph (Donna), Theresa (Herman), Nelson (Velma), Homer (Stella), Bianca (Roger), Rena (Leo), Eileen, Lorraine (Chris), Velma (Terry), Diane, Simone (David), and Maurice (Diane).
Zita was very creative and devoted to using her talented skills in making beautiful quilts for her children, grandchildren, and great-grandchildren. She made wedding dresses for all family brides and bridesmaids.
She was a member of the Daughters of Isabella for 60 years and was proudly inducted to the Penetanguishene Sports Hall of Fame. She loved doing puzzles (1,000 pieces - no less). She knitted many toques, mitts, socks, and scarves to keep us warm and hand-sewn boxers for her grown boys and P.Js for the kids.
